




Intermediate and advanced riders, get ready to fly with the Burton Yeasayer Flying V.
This board features the Flying V® and promises high-flying sensations. The Yeasayer Flying V was originally designed for freestyle but now offers more versatility in powder snow.
The Flying V® hybrid camber improves float of the Yeasayer Flying V in powder and makes the board easier to handle than with a traditional camber. The Flying V is also more forgiving on spin landings. It has a lower weight thanks to the bi-density Super Fly II™ 800G Core with Dualzone™ EGD™ . The Yeasayer Flying V also features some essential technologies which will give you all the confidence you need.
If you're looking to impress other riders at the park with a balanced ride, you'll love the perfectly symmetrical twin shape and soft flex, distributed equally from the Yeasayer Flying V's nose to tail. No snags on the bars thanks to the Scoop nose and tail! On hard snow, the Flying V camber won't grip as hard as its Fat Top camber counterpart.
The Burton Yeasayer Flying V will suit intermediate and advanced snowboarders who want to have fun in powder as well as the park.



Camber - Flying V® : The Flying V profile has sloping areas between and around your feet for added fun, and float and cambered areas under your feet which increase edge control for clean pressure, more pop and powerful turns.
Shape - Twin : The Twin Flex is perfectly symmetrical from nose to tail for a balanced and versatile ride in a classic or switch style.
Flex - Twin: The twin flex is perfectly symmetrical on the tip and tail for a balanced and versatile ride in regular or switch style
Core - - FSC® Certified Super Fly® 800G Core with Dualzone® EGD® and Squeezebox: The Super Fly 800G core is a highly dynamic dual wood core with alternating hard and soft woods, for reduced overall weight without limiting performance. Woodgrain, designed with Dualzone EGD, is positioned along the edges under the toe and heel in two continuous areas, perpendicular to the rest of the wood core, for consistent edge grip and enhanced energy.
Fiberglass - Triax® : The Triax fibreglass model tailored to the female body type offers a softer torsional flex for lighter riders, while still providing the power and responsiveness needed for all riding styles.
Base - Extruded: Extruded sole offers speed and durability and requires little maintenance
Technology:
- The Channel® : The Channel® snowboard mounting system is designed to allow you to find the perfect position, and is compatible with the major brands' bindings.
- Epoxy Super Sap® Super Sap® is a resin made from biological materials which reduces the carbon footprint by 50% compared to conventional petroleum-based epoxies. Reduced oil consumption means a smaller carbon footprint for every snowboard, which definitely works in our favour.
- Infinite Ride™: a technology which ensures that the snowboard retains its initial flex, pop and behaviour throughout its lifespan.
-Pro-Tip™ : the nose and tail are thinner than the rest of the board for more lightness and better handling.
